Just five days on from their capitulation at Villa Park, strikerless (sorry Jonah!) Fulham head to the scene of one of last season's crimes, the Vitality Stadium.
But is a game against Andoni Iraola's punchy, pressing Bournemouth side the last thing we need right now?
Who can step up to offer some much needed creativity and firepower? With no Kenny Tete to keep tabs on Antoine Semenyo, can Marco Silva's men keep it tight at the back? And how on earth have our opponents thrown in key new recruits with no hesitation when we seem so reluctant to do the same?
Sam, Kish and Bournemouth fan James look to answer those questions (whilst also bonding over some shared Scott Parker slander) in this earlier than usual preview of our Friday night fixture.
